Output 62c14f40eefc2a931b4148e47ee8f82d56fb690013bfac1a5f657665bb450c0e:2

value
297101784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8807ac65f287e90ce1bfc57ca14e500471a2092 OP_EQUAL
address
MQiiUePEYfoh7DHCeMDcZQMnNRp92QHxbW
transaction
62c14f40eefc2a931b4148e47ee8f82d56fb690013bfac1a5f657665bb450c0e
spent
true